Locals not consulted over plans for gas electricity plant in Galway
There is controversy in Co Galway over plans for a €300m gas powered electricity generating plant.
The Quinn Group is planning the venture as it wants to enter the electricity market here.
It is also proposing a second plant for Co Louth.
Locals in Derrydonnell, Co Galway, say they haven't been consulted.
An Bord Pleanála is assessing the proposals.
Quinn Group technical director Ciaran Leonard has said they will be happy to discuss their plans, which are in the very early stages.
